Why does going vegan stop hair growth?

Going vegan means cutting all meat out of your diet as well as all animal byproducts. This change can lead to a sudden drop in protein intake. When your body has low protein levels, one of the first things your body does is to stop hair growth to conserve energy for more essential body functions.

Why is vegan diet good for hair?

Protein Problem. A vegan diet must include a wide-range of high-protein foods in order to obtain enough for hair cell renewal and nourishment . Proteins provide the energy needed for healthy tissue growth not only for your hair, but for vital tissues like your heart, lungs, and liver.

How many hairs does vegan hair lose?

Sometimes, a lack of proper nutrition and knowledge on nutrition can lead to excessive vegan hair loss. On average, a person loses 100 to 200 hairs a day. If you notice more strands falling out and brittle ends, consult a health care professional to screen for underlying health problems.

Can vegans lose hair?

Iron, which is commonly found in whole grains and red meat, is often an issue for those that go vegan. Having an iron as well as other vitamin deficiencies can lead to you having hair loss.

Can vegans have thyroid issues?

Anyone who goes vegan often has an increase in their soy intake. If you suffer with thyroid problems, soy can greatly worsen this issue. The problem is made worse when your body is low on iodine. When you have thyroid problems, these often result in hair thinning.
